currently tryin to bulk my tiny 5'4" frame up,looking for advice on whats best to eat and does my training routine look ok,i currently work for 2 weeks on one routine then change about as not to let the body get used to it,anything i could add/takeaway from my diet or change to my workout to get the best gains,cheers in advance


5am protein shake, 100g oats

8.30am 3 slice brown bread with chicken and salad,banana

10am bag of roast chicken bites

12pm tin of tuna,apple

2pm pasta or baked potato/cheese,tub of strawberry yoghurt,protien shake,100g oats

2.30pm gym workout immediatley followed by 50g waxy maize starch and 5mg creapure

4pm 3-4 eggs,protein shake


6pm 2 chicken breasts with salad or steak with new potatoes and pepper sauce,


8.30pm protein shake,fruit bowl



monday shoulders and chest

tuesday biceps and legs,abs

wednesday rest

thursday back and neck

friday tri's and abs

saturday health suite

sunday rest
